I used a hot soldering iron to heat the glue and pull the straps off, if you don't have one I also heated up the glue gun and pressed the tip into the glue to soften it and take off the straps.

i was just wondering if using eva foam is better than card stock when it comes to building and painting.
 
Re: IRON MAN Mark 4/6 Pepakura FOAM Templates- *Video Tutorial Link in first Post*

Foam is quicker and easier to work with, but you typically get "better" results with card/bondo, given skill level of course

Re: IRON MAN Mark 4/6 Pepakura FOAM Templates- *Video Tutorial Link in first Post*

Alright guys, BEST WAY TO JOIN THE JOINTS? haha!

I have been using the book binding screws from Hobby Lobby but they always seem to unscrew and my thighs end up resting in my calfs!

why don't you hot glue them, then screw them in quickly, then hot glue the outside? That's what I do. They never unscrew.

better yet, superglue?

Just make sure to not get any on the armor itself and it ends up gluing the screw to the joint hole.
